Snowdonia.

Day 1 - Zipworld caverns (much more interesting than the one big zipline there)
Day 2 - Go up Snowdon
Day 3 - Coed Y Brenin - Hire some mountain bikes and do some trails there
Day 4 - One of the million other outdoor activities in the area, or head to Barmouth for rubbish seaside arcades and fish and chips by the beach.

Plenty of adventure options, plenty of more relaxed options :)
